Casino Player Posted May 20, 2009 #57 Share Posted May 20, 2009 [quote name='jtpost84']Hi everyone, Heard rumors that Carnival has a Past Guest Cocktail Party. Can anyone tell me exactly what this entails? And is it on every cruise? Thanks! Joe[/quote] [SIZE=3][COLOR=darkgreen]Past guest parties are on most cruises. I don't remember one being on a C-T-N. It entails getting dressed, usually a jacket is suggested, and having cocktails with h'douveres. Then the Cruise Director will ask who was on this ship then will run down the list of Carnival ships. [/COLOR][/SIZE] [SIZE=3][COLOR=#006400][/COLOR][/SIZE] [SIZE=3][COLOR=#006400]One of the long running Carnival jokes is the Cruise Director will name ships then he'll slip in, "The Constipation" then someone will applaud and the CD will state, "that ship hasn't been built yet."[/COLOR][/SIZE]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
